about summary refs log tree commit diff stats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/config/toml.nim2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/config/toml.nim b/src/config/toml.nim
index 8d65de79..bcba3d22 100644
--- a/src/config/toml.nim
+++ b/src/config/toml.nim
@@ -370,7 +370,7 @@ proc consumeNumber(state: var TomlParser, c: char): TomlResult =
       return state.err("invalid number")
     repr &= c
 
-  var was_num = true
+  var was_num = repr.len > 0 and repr[0] in AsciiDigit
   while state.has():
     if isDigit(state.peek(0)):
       repr &= state.consume()